Keening

6 Sentences | 4 Meanings

Usage Examples

Filter by Meaning
The keening sound of the ambulance pierced through the silence of the night.
The keening wail of the baby echoed through the nursery, causing concern among the caregivers.
The horror movie was accompanied by a soundtrack of keening voices, adding to the creepy atmosphere.
The widow sat alone in her empty house, keening softly for the husband she had lost.
The young child stood by the graveside, keening for his pet dog that had passed away.
The sound of keening could be heard from afar, drawing people to the funeral grounds to pay their respects.
